html {width:100%; height:100%; margin:0;padding:0;}
body {width:100%; height:100%; background:#fff;margin:0;padding:0; font: normal 12px arial, sans-serif; color: #206184;}
h1 {font: italic normal 20px arial, sans-serif;}
h1 a {color: #206184; text-decoration: none;}
h1 a:visited {color: #206184; text-decoration: none;}
h1 a:hover {color: #B93C40; text-decoration: none;}
h2 {font: normal bold 14px arial, sans-serif; color: #B93C40;}
h3 {font: normal bold 13px arial, sans-serif;}
ul {list-style-type:square;}
hr {color: #CFE2E2; height:2px;}
a {color: #293214; text-decoration: underline;}
a:vistied {color: #475622;}
a:hover {color: #272B55; text-decoration: underline;}
.icont {background: URL(bg-bco.gif) scroll no-repeat; width:800px; height:773px; text-align: center; margin:0; position: absolute; left: 50%; margin-left: -400px; }
.icont-l {background: URL(bg-bco-lang.gif) scroll no-repeat; width:800px; height:1063px; text-align: center; margin:0; position: absolute; left: 50%; margin-left: -400px; }
.cont { width:782px; height:500px; margin: 22px 0 0 0; padding: 4px 10px 4px 8px; border-top:0;}
.cont-l { width:782px; height:840px; margin: 22px 0 0 0; padding: 4px 10px 4px 8px; border-top:0;}
.formular {border: solid 2px #CFE2E2;}
.formular:focus {border: solid 2px #fc0;}
.stern {font: normal bold 14px arial, sans-serif;}
.subul {list-style-type:circle; margin: 0 -10px;}
.sb {font: normal small-caps bold 16px verdana, sans-serif;color:#5894A3;}
.sb2 {font: normal small-caps bold 16px verdana, sans-serif;color:#fff;background:#395B63;}
#nav_ul {list-style-image:url(p.gif);margin: 0;}
#nav_ul li {margin: 0 0 0 -4px;}
#nav_ul li a {text-decoration: none;}

#nav_ziele_ul {list-style-image: none; list-style-type: circle;;margin: 0 0 0 -8px;}
#nav_ziele_ul li {margin: 0 0 0 -20px; font: normal small-caps bold 0.8em arial, sans-serif;}
#nav_ziele_ul li a {text-decoration: none;}


#h-h1 {color: #206184; font: italic normal 20px arial, sans-serif; margin: 48px 0 0 4px;letter-spacing: 0.03em;}
#h-img {margin: 16px 0 0 0; }


#in_head2 { position: relative; top: -556px; left:20px; color: #fff; font: normal bold 17px arial, sans-serif; margin:0;}
#in_head_2 { position: relative; top: 15px; left:20px; color: #000; font: normal bold 30px arial, sans-serif; margin:0;}
#in_head2_2 { position: relative; top: 19px; left:20px; color: #fff; font: normal bold 17px arial, sans-serif; margin:0;}
#ndiv { position: absolute; top: 150px; left:0; z-index: 1010; font: normal bold 11px arial, sans-serif; color: #DAE8E8;}
#ndiv a { color: #FBFDFD;}
#nav-1 { position: relative; top: 47px; left:20px; letter-spacing: 0.1em; }
#nav-2 { position: relative; top: -94px; left:434px; letter-spacing: 0.1em; }
#imp { position: relative; top: -170px; left:590px; letter-spacing: 0.1em; font-size: 10px; font-weight: normal;}
#imp a {color: #206184; text-decoration: underline;}
#fuss { margin: 2px 8px;}
#kontakt {background: #F2F7F7; padding: 4px 5px 0 4px; border: solid 1px #ccc; margin: 0 10px 0 0;}
#aw {font: normal 0.8em arial, sans-serif;}